Illinois Code § 205 ILCS 635/4-13

Violations of this Act; Commissioner's Orders.

If the
Commissioner finds, as the result of examination, investigation or review
of reports submitted by a licensee that the business and affairs of a
licensee are not being conducted in accordance with this Act, the
Commissioner shall notify the licensee of the correction necessary. Should
a licensee fail to correct such violations, the Commissioner shall issue an
order requiring immediate correction and compliance with this Act,
specifying a reasonable date for performance.

 
The Commissioner shall promulgate rules and regulations to provide for an
orderly and timely appeal of all orders within the Office of the Commissioner.
Such rules shall include provision for assessment of fees and costs.
